The Role

We are looking for a highly motivated apprentice who is interested in working in Financial Services and wishes to pursue a career in Technology.  

You will be part of Corporate Functions Technology (CFT), which looks across many areas of technology and contributes to the day to day running of the company. This includes: 

  • Corporate Functions Technology (managing and implementing Technology solutions for Finance, HR, Risk) 
  • The Chief Data Office – specialising in Data Governance, Data Management & Data Strategy for M&G. 
  • Service Management 
  • Support 

The successful applicant will join the Business Operations Team, who are responsible for the day to day running of the Corporate Functions Tech Team; we are responsible for the CFT Financials, ensuring that we are on top of forecasting and budgeting, ensuring our software and licence renewals are managed effectively, managing business case impacts to our cost base as well as monthly activities around invoicing & approvals. We also manage the workforce planning, interlocking delivery to understand what our people are working on, and we co-ordinate recruitment for hiring and demand. Finally, we look after the people and comms strategy for the team, ensuring that everyone remains engaged and motivated and that everyone has the right skills to do their jobs, by planning team events, training, and offsite activities. 

What will you be doing?

As the Business Operations Apprentice, your daily duties will include: 

  • Supporting the development of resource planning models.  
  • Co-ordinating contractor extensions and new hiring requests. 
  • Updating and maintaining commercial tracking for our software contracts. 
  • Help advise our wider team on how to navigate the CFT project delivery governance framework. 
  • Helping develop our people strategy by contributing to our newsletters, articles & being a member of our people working group. 
  • Ad-hoc projects to support the Corporate Functions Technology Leadership Team (such as building reporting dashboards, building presentations, gathering project requirements). 
  • Attending meetings and supporting implementation of projects

Training Provided

As a Technology Business Support Apprentice with M&G, you will undertake the Business Administration SCQF Level 6 Apprenticeship. The apprenticeship will be delivered through a blend of live online learning, pre-recorded lectures, and face to face inductions and masterclasses

Future Prospects

This is a fixed term contract for 18 - 23 months upon which the business may decide to retain, subject to the Apprentice performance, headcount, and available funding. If recruited into a permanent role, the individual will follow the career progression applicable to the specific role/department.

Salary

£22,900  per annum plus benefits

What We Do

M&G plc is a leading international savings and investments business, managing money for around 4.6 million individual clients and more than 900 institutional clients in 38 offices worldwide. As at 31 December 2023, we had £343.5 billion of assets under management and administration. Our purpose is to give everyone real confidence to put their money to work.

With a heritage dating back more than 175 years, M&G plc has a long history of innovation in savings and investments, combining asset management and insurance expertise to offer a wide range of solutions. Our three distinct operating segments, Asset Management, Life and Wealth, work together to provide access to balanced, long-term investment and savings solutions.
